My Buying Guides on Mary Kay Face Cleansing Cloths
1. Why I Consider Face Cleansing Cloths
When I look for a cleansing cloth, I want something that makes my skincare routine quick, easy, and effective. Mary Kay Face Cleansing Cloths are convenient for removing makeup, dirt, and oil without needing a full wash setup. For me, they’re especially useful after a long day, during travel, or when I want a simple cleanse before bed.
2. What I Look for in Mary Kay Face Cleansing Cloths
I always check a few important things before buying. First, I want the cloths to feel gentle on my skin, especially if my face is sensitive. I also look for how well they remove makeup, including stubborn products like mascara and foundation. Another thing I pay attention to is whether they leave my skin feeling clean but not stripped or dry.
3. My Experience with Skin Compatibility
For me, skin compatibility matters a lot. I prefer products that suit normal, dry, oily, or combination skin without causing irritation. If I have sensitive skin, I make sure to review the ingredients and avoid anything that feels too harsh. I also like cleansing cloths that are dermatologically friendly and suitable for daily use.
4. Convenience and Portability
One of the biggest reasons I buy face cleansing cloths is convenience. I like that I can keep them in my bathroom, gym bag, or suitcase. Mary Kay Face Cleansing Cloths are practical when I’m traveling or when I need a quick refresh. I always consider the packaging size and whether it seals well to keep the cloths moist.
5. How I Judge the Cleansing Performance
I want cleansing cloths that actually work. In my experience, a good cloth should remove makeup and impurities in one or two passes without rubbing too hard. I also prefer cloths that don’t leave behind a sticky residue. If I have to use several wipes to get the job done, I usually don’t see it as a good value.
6. Value for Money
When I buy Mary Kay Face Cleansing Cloths, I compare the price to the number of wipes in the pack and the overall quality. I think about how often I’ll use them and whether they fit into my skincare budget. For me, the best choice is not always the cheapest one, but the one that gives me the best balance of quality, comfort, and convenience.
